#fee2e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fee2e0 is composed of 99.6% red, 88.6%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 4 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 93.7%. #fee2e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fdc5c1.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#fee2e0 color description : Light grayish red.
#fee2e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fee2e0 has RGB values of R:254, G:226,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.12, K:0. Its decimal value is 16704224.
